All right. I want to be a little clearer about exactly what I've done. I was in a hurry to go to work earlier and I think that I was a little vague.

I'm following the tutorial and I'll explain in detail how I responded to each step:

1: Check your Windows\startup folder for "HTC_CM_Guardian.lnk", which is a shortcut to Windows\HTC_CM_Guardian.exe. If the shortcut exists delete it. If not then you probably have a newer Sprint ROM which doesn't have the shortcut to launch that application. It is still launching it in some other way however and I have not been able to figure it out from searching forums and the web. The general consensus is to replace the file with a dummy file that I've attached (extract from the zip). Download the attached file and replace "Windows\HTC_CM_Guardian.exe" with the dummy file which will prevent it from running.

I checked my windows folder, but I'm using Juicy 4.3 and I think that this file is not included in the ROM. In any case, it is not there.

2: Rename the following files and folders:

Windows\iota.exe ---> windows\iotaOLD.exe
Windows\iotaconf.txt ---> windows\iotaconfgOLD.txt
Program Files\IOTA ---> Program Files\IOTAOLD


Once again, these files are not in my windows folder. I'm not sure what effect these files have on my connection, but I was unable to edit them.

3: Open your phone and enter ##778#, select "EDIT" and enter your unlock code.

I did this with no problem. My unlock code was just 000000.

4: Set the following values:

M.IP Settings:
MIP_MODE = Simple IP Only

M.IP Default Profile:
NAI = yourtendigitphonenumber@mymetropcs.com
Home Address = 0.0.0.0 (just delete the values and save)
Primary HA Address = 0.0.0.0 (just delete the values and save)
Secondary HA Address = 0.0.0.0 (just delete the values and save)

Security:
HDR AN AUTH User Id = yourtendigitphonenumber@mymetropcs.com
PPP USER ID = yourtendigitphonenumber@mymetropcs.com
PPP PASSWORD = metropcs


My number is 972-781-8284, so I used the following:

M.IP Settings:
MIP_MODE = Simple IP Only

M.IP Default Profile:
NAI = 9727818284@mymetropcs.com
Home Address = 0.0.0.0 (set to 0.0.0.0)
Primary HA Address = 0.0.0.0 (set to 0.0.0.0)
Secondary HA Address = 0.0.0.0 (set to 0.0.0.0)

Security:
HDR AN AUTH User Id = 9727818284@mymetropcs.com
PPP USER ID = 9727818284@mymetropcs.com
PPP PASSWORD = set to metropcs

5: Goto Connections and delete any existing connections and setup a new one using the following settings:

Number to dail = #777
Username: yourtendigitphonenumber@mymetropcs.com
Password: metropcs
Domain: (Leave Blank)

Select Proxy Settings and enter the following values:
wap.metropcs.net port:3128 (http)
wap.metropcs.net port:3128 (wap)
wap.metropcs.net port:443 (secure wap)
wap.metropcs.net port:3128 (socks)


I changed my settings to this:

Number to diall = #777
Username: 9727818284@mymetropcs.com
Password: metropcs
Domain: (Left Blank)

I set my proxies to the following values:
wap.metropcs.net port:3128 (http)
wap.metropcs.net port:3128 (wap)
wap.metropcs.net port:443 (secure wap)
wap.metropcs.net port:3128 (socks)


So I click on the new connection and select the "Connect" option. It tries to connect and then it says that my username and password is wrong for #777. I try to go on the web and it won't connect. Also, when I go back and look at the connection, it deletes what I entered for the http option in the proxy settings. The other 3 settings are still there (wap, secure wap, and socks).

I'm not sure what else to try. I used the *228 option and updated my PRL firmware. It still doesn't let me connect. Please help!!!
